CI note — GPU memory profiler (Velk tooling). memprobe job fails on the Ardent runners: profiler hooks allocate before CUDA context init, so peak numbers are garbage. Pinned hook load to post-init and re-ran the bench suite; deltas within 2%. On-call: if the job reds again, restart the runner pool first. Passing run token below.

build token for haduf-bafog: htk21_2d98ce91a83676b65394a

## Firmware Update Channels — Emberline Environments

Emberline pushes device firmware through three channels: canary, beta, and stable. On-call owns promotions between channels; the rollout daemon halts automatically if failure telemetry from the Quillport fleet exceeds threshold. Rollbacks are channel-scoped, so demoting stable does not affect beta devices. Before paging the firmware team, verify the channel state matches what is deployed. The current stable-channel configuration is as follows.

service settings:
[casax]
port = 6379
team = rusir
host = casax.zemvarhq.corp
region = outer-4
access_code = ac_9808ce
timeout_ms = 1500

TURN-208: Gatevale turnstile counters at the Merrow Field pilot double-count when a rotation reverses mid-cycle. Attendance totals drift roughly 2% high per event. The debounce window fix is implemented, reviewed by Ilsa, and soak-tested across two simulated match days without drift. Ready for your cut; the candidate build is identified below.

trace token, tagag-tafog: htk6_5ed18c